728x90
import java.util.List;
import java.util.function.Predicate;
import java.util.stream.Collectors;
import java.util.stream.IntStream;
class Solution {
public int solution(String my_string, String is_suffix) {
List<String> collect = IntStream.range(0, my_string.length())
.mapToObj(my_string::substring)
.collect(Collectors.toList());
return collect.stream().anyMatch(Predicate.isEqual(is_suffix)) ? 1 : 0;
}
}
다른 사람의 풀이
class Solution {
public int solution(String myString, String isSuffix) {
return myString.endsWith(isSuffix) ? 1 : 0;
}
}
728x90
반응형
'Algorithm > 프로그래머스' 카테고리의 다른 글
[알고리즘] 배열 회전시키기 Java (0) | 2023.07.05 |
---|---|
[알고리즘] 공 던지기 Java (0) | 2023.07.04 |
[알고리즘] 접미사 배열 Java (0) | 2023.06.27 |
[알고리즘] 콜라츠 수열 만들기 Java (0) | 2023.06.25 |
[알고리즘] 조건에 맞게 수열 변환하기 3 Java (0) | 2023.06.22 |